I am using salicylic acid cleanser and niacinamide serum. Does using orange peel paste once a week affects skin or will it get along with salicylic acid and niacinamide skin care routine

Female | 22

This is a safe approach if you include orange peel paste in your skin care regime once per week. However, one must be aware that it could irritate or sensitize the skin in some cases. Be sure to do a patch test with the orange peel paste before using it along side salicylic acid cleanser and niacinamide serumand if any adverse reaction occurs, then stop its use.

I got hurt from a plastic chair and a small piece of my skin came off near my foot..It started bleeding but i didn't notice ..when i saw the wound the blood was already dried up so i cleaned it with water and didn't apply anything on it.. It's been 5 days since the injury and the wound is not healing..i applied some antiseptic cream on it later..it just hurts around that area and some kind of transparent liquid comes out occasionally.. what to do

Male | 19

The transparent liquid you see coming out is likely pus, a sign of infection. Try cleaning the wound daily with mild soap and warm water, then apply an antibiotic ointment. Keep it covered with a bandage to protect it. If it doesn't improve in a couple of days or if you notice increasing redness, swelling, or warmth around the wound, it's best to seek medical help.
